The Hating Game by Talli Roland
My rating: 5 of 5 stars

Mattie Johns is a snarky, mean, calculating, bitchy character. But you still want to find out what happens to her – even if it’s only to see her get her comeuppance. It was fun reading about a heroine who was so very different to the normal chicklit heroine.
The title, and the game show that features in the book, is great idea. The Hating Game. Mattie has to go on dates which four exes and then has to spend two weeks with the ‘winner’. That would be easy if it wasn’t for that fact that one such ex, Kyle, is the one she actually wants to be with.
Partway through the book I thought there was a clichéd happy ending coming. Then there was a twist which changed the story completely and increased the tension.
This is a very different sort of chick lit book written with wit and a touch of cynicism. It’s a breath of fresh air.
